Use strong straps or chains

When securing plastic pipes on a flatbed, it is important to use straps or chains that are strong enough to support the weight of the pipes. This is a crucial step in ensuring the safety of the cargo and other road users.

The Federal Motor Carrier Safety Administration (FMCSA) recommends securing pipes at regular 10-foot intervals. If you are loading the pipes laterally, use a chock block and strap or chain the pipes internally at opposing 45-degree angles at the front and rear of the load. This will help to prevent the load from shifting.

When using straps or chains, it is important to inspect them for any damage that could affect the unloading process. Loose straps or chains can pose a danger and should be avoided. Additionally, it is recommended to use edge protectors, also known as corner protectors, to prevent the straps from damaging the edges of the pipes. These protectors are typically made of durable materials such as rubber or plastic and help distribute the pressure of the straps evenly.

For extremely heavy or oversized pipes, chains and binders can be used instead of straps. Chains offer added strength and durability, while binders allow for precise tensioning and securement of the load. Lever binders, also known as chain binders, use mechanical leverage to tighten chains or straps, ensuring a tight and secure hold.

By following these guidelines and using strong straps or chains, you can effectively secure plastic pipes on a flatbed while ensuring the safety and integrity of the cargo during transport.

Prevent pipes from rolling

Preventing pipes from rolling is a critical safety issue when transporting them on a flatbed. The Federal Motor Carrier Safety Administration (FMCSA) recommends specific safety measures to ensure the safe transportation of pipes. Here are some detailed steps to prevent pipes from rolling:

Firstly, prepare the flatbed surface by clearing any debris and laying friction mats. Then, lay down dunnage, which is packing material such as lumber, blocks, or pads, to create a cradle for the pipes. Dunnage helps to fill empty spaces, stabilise the load, and prevent movement. For larger pipes that need stacking, place additional dunnage between layers and around the perimeter.

Next, carefully arrange the pipes on the flatbed. When dealing with different-sized pipes, load the heaviest at the bottom and the lighter ones on top. Ensure the pipes are touching each other, as this helps resist rolling. For pipes less than 18" in diameter, use V-boards or a 2x4 to prevent sideways movement. If the pipes are loaded laterally, use a chock block and strap or chain them internally at opposing 45-degree angles at the front and rear to prevent shifting.

Once the pipes are arranged, use ratchet straps or chains to secure them tightly to the flatbed. The FMCSA recommends a minimum of one tie-down for every 10 feet of cargo. For coated pipes, be cautious as they can become extremely slippery when wet or icy. In such cases, use 4x4 timbers with nailed blocking wedges to keep the pipes from rolling before securing them with straps or chains.

Additionally, consider using pipe stakes or the cinch strap method as alternatives or supplementary measures to enhance security. The cinch strap method involves running winch straps across the bed before loading the pipes, then running the straps over the load and securing them on the opposite side, creating a tight loop.

Use dunnage to fill empty spaces

Dunnage is a shipping term for the materials used to protect cargo during transportation. It is an inexpensive way to ensure that cargo reaches its destination in the same condition it was loaded. Dunnage materials include wood, plastic, air pillows, bubble wrap, kraft paper, crinkle paper, planks, blocks, and boards.

When transporting plastic pipes on a flatbed, dunnage can be used to fill empty spaces and prevent the pipes from shifting or toppling during transit. This helps to maintain the stability of the pipes and prevents any potential damage. Dunnage can also be used to distribute the weight of the pipes evenly across the flatbed, reducing stress on any single part of the bed and making the ride smoother and safer.

There are a variety of dunnage materials that can be used to secure plastic pipes on a flatbed. Solid wood or plastic dunnage can be used to secure the pipes and distribute their weight evenly. Bubble wrap is another popular option, especially for fragile items. It provides a lightweight protective cushion that absorbs shocks and vibrations. Foam dunnage is also versatile and can be custom-moulded to fit the shape of the pipes.

Dunnage racks are another option for securing cargo on a flatbed. These racks raise the cargo off the ground, preventing damage from dirt or flooding. They also improve airflow and provide easy access for cleaning. Dunnage racks can be made of durable materials such as aluminium and can be locked for extra security.

Overall, using dunnage to fill empty spaces when transporting plastic pipes on a flatbed is an important step in ensuring the safety and stability of the cargo. By choosing the appropriate type of dunnage, pipes can be securely hauled while also optimising the loading capacity of the flatbed.

Safety flags and lights

Safety is a critical issue when transporting plastic pipes on a flatbed trailer. It's not just about ensuring the pipes arrive undamaged; it's also about reducing the risk of accidents and injuries. Before loading the pipes, it's essential to inspect the flatbed trailer for any damage that could compromise the safety of the load and clean the deck of any debris.

When it comes to safety flags and lights, these are crucial components to enhance the visibility of your load, especially when transporting pipes that extend beyond the dimensions of the flatbed. Safety flags are typically bright-coloured flags, often red or orange, that are attached to the ends of the protruding pipes. These flags act as a visual warning to other drivers, indicating that your load exceeds the standard dimensions. Similarly, safety lights can be used to mark oversized loads, especially when travelling at night or in low-visibility conditions. These lights are usually bright, flashing lights that are placed at the front and rear of the load.

The specific regulations for safety flags and lights may vary depending on your location and the relevant road authorities' guidelines. In the United States, for example, the Federal Motor Carrier Safety Administration (FMCSA) provides guidelines for cargo securement, including the use of safety flags and lights. It's important to familiarise yourself with these regulations to ensure compliance and maintain safety on the road.

In addition to safety flags and lights, it's essential to follow other safety protocols when transporting plastic pipes on a flatbed. This includes wearing appropriate Personal Protective Equipment (PPE), such as safety glasses, gloves, and hard hats, during the loading and unloading process. Regular inspections of the load during transit are also crucial, especially after the first few miles and following any changes in speed, curves, turns, or inclines. These inspections allow you to identify and rectify any issues, such as loose straps or chains, before they become hazardous.

Furthermore, it's important to consider the securement of the pipes themselves. Ratchet straps, winch straps, and chains can be used to securely fasten the pipes to the flatbed. When using ratchet straps, ensure even tension across the load, and consider using edge protectors to prevent damage to the pipes and securement devices. For heavier or oversized pipes, chains and binders can be utilised, providing added strength and allowing for precise tensioning. Dunnage, or packing material, is also essential to create a cradle for the pipes and prevent them from rolling during transport.

Check for damage

When transporting plastic pipes on a flatbed, it is crucial to check for damage to ensure the safety of the load and prevent accidents. Here are some detailed steps to inspect for damage:

Firstly, always inspect the pipes for any signs of damage before securing them to the flatbed. Look for scratches, cracks, dents, or any other imperfections that could compromise the integrity of the pipes during transit. Even minor damage can lead to bigger issues, so it's important to be thorough in your inspection.

Secondly, check the straps, chains, or winch straps for any wear and tear. Examine the entire length of the straps or chains, looking for cuts, tears, fraying, or weakened areas. Ensure all buckles, hooks, or winches are in good working condition and free of damage. Damaged straps or securing equipment can lead to pipes becoming loose during transport, creating a hazardous situation.

Thirdly, inspect the flatbed itself for any damage. Ensure the surface is clean and free of debris, objects, or residue that could damage the pipes or interfere with their securement. Look for any structural damage to the flatbed, such as dents, bends, or rusted areas, especially where the pipes will be resting. Friction mats or anti-slip mats should also be inspected to ensure they are in good condition and free of tears or excessive wear, providing an effective non-slip surface.

Additionally, if using edge protectors or corner protectors, check that they are in good condition and made of durable materials such as rubber or plastic. These protectors are crucial in preventing straps from damaging the edges of the pipes, especially when securing sharp or heavy pipes. Ensure enough protectors are available to distribute the strap's pressure evenly and safeguard the pipes from damage.

Finally, during the unloading process, remain vigilant for any signs of damage. Inspect the pipes as they are unloaded, and be cautious of loose straps or chains that could pose a danger. Awareness of your surroundings is crucial to prevent accidental damage to the pipes, the flatbed, or nearby people and vehicles.

The cinch strap method is a good way to strap plastic pipes on a flatbed. Before loading the pipes, run a winch strap across the bed and secure it on one side. Then, position two or three additional straps, evenly spaced, the same way. Once the pipes are loaded, run the straps over the load, back underneath, and secure them on the opposite side.

The cinch strap method keeps the load firmly on the trailer. It also protects pipe stakes in the event that the load breaks loose.

It is important to ensure that the pipes are securely strapped to prevent them from rolling off the flatbed and causing accidents. Use safety flags and lights to mark oversized or protruding loads. Always check for any damage to the pipes or straps before loading and unloading.

Winch straps, load binders, chains, edge protectors, anti-slip mats, and rubber tarp straps can all be used to secure plastic pipes on a flatbed.

Straps or chains should be used at regular 10-foot intervals per FMCSA specifications. For coated pipes, place 4"x 4" timbers on the trailer deck every 8 feet for the length of the pipe and secure each row with two straps or chains.
